| ; Test to make sure unused llvm.invariant.start calls are not trivially eliminated
 | |
| ; RUN: opt < %s -instcombine -S | FileCheck %s
 | |
| 
 | |
| declare void @g(i8*)
 | |
| declare void @g_addr1(i8 addrspace(1)*)
 | |
| 
 | |
| declare {}* @llvm.invariant.start.p0i8(i64, i8* nocapture) nounwind readonly
 | |
| declare {}* @llvm.invariant.start.p1i8(i64, i8 addrspace(1)* nocapture) nounwind readonly
 | |
| 
 | |
| define i8 @f() {
 | |
|   %a = alloca i8                                  ; <i8*> [#uses=4]
 | |
|   store i8 0, i8* %a
 | |
|   %i = call {}* @llvm.invariant.start.p0i8(i64 1, i8* %a) ; <{}*> [#uses=0]
 | |
|   ; CHECK: call {}* @llvm.invariant.start.p0i8
 | |
|   call void @g(i8* %a)
 | |
|   %r = load i8, i8* %a                                ; <i8> [#uses=1]
 | |
|   ret i8 %r
 | |
| }
 | |
| 
 | |
| ; make sure llvm.invariant.call in non-default addrspace are also not eliminated.
 | |
| define i8 @f_addrspace1(i8 addrspace(1)* %a) {
 | |
|   store i8 0, i8 addrspace(1)* %a
 | |
|   %i = call {}* @llvm.invariant.start.p1i8(i64 1, i8 addrspace(1)* %a) ; <{}*> [#uses=0]
 | |
|   ; CHECK: call {}* @llvm.invariant.start.p1i8
 | |
|   call void @g_addr1(i8 addrspace(1)* %a)
 | |
|   %r = load i8, i8 addrspace(1)* %a                                ; <i8> [#uses=1]
 | |
|   ret i8 %r
 | |
| }
